Summary

Since Russia’s invasion of Ukraine in February 2022, there have been numerous reports of unidentified aerial phenomena observed over the conflict zone. These include sightings by military personnel on both sides, detections by air defense systems, and systematic observations by Ukrainian astronomers. In a remarkable scientific paper, astronomers from Kyiv documented “phantom” objects traveling at speeds up to 15 kilometers per second. Military sources have reported metallic objects hovering over battle zones, mysterious lights accompanying military operations, and radar contacts that don’t match known aircraft. While some incidents may be attributable to new military technologies or battlefield conditions, others display characteristics that defy conventional explanation, adding an unexpected dimension to an already complex conflict.

”Phantom” Objects

Researchers documented:

  • Dark objects against sky
  • Speeds up to 15 km/s
  • No optical signatures
  • Size estimates 3-12 meters
  • Multiple simultaneous objects
  • Beyond conventional explanation
